Unpaid Bills When an unpaid bill notice is received, forward a copy to your Resident Contracts Coordinator. The Resident Contracts Coordinator will send a letter to the Prime Contractor with a copy to the P.A. The P.A. is to contact the Prime Contractor and determine if there is good cause demonstrated for not paying the sub. The PA should communicate this information to the Resident Contracts Coordinator. http://www.dot.state.fl.us/construction/manuals/cpa m/New%20Clean%20Chapters/Chapter6s1.pdf http://www.dot.state.fl.us/construction/manuals/cpa m/New%20Clean%20Chapters/Chapter6s1.pdf
4
Unpaid Bills If it is discovered that the Prime Contractor does not have good cause for withholding payment, then the DCE will determine if further payments will be made. The P.A. will inform the contractor in writing of this decision The Certification Disbursement of Previous Payment to Subcontractors should reflect any unpaid bill claims and include the required back-up documentation.

Material Certification The search engine at the link here below helps research the requirement for any material. The ones requiring a certification will either be sampled by project personnel (PP) and tested by PP… or sampled by PP and tested by Central Lab (CL) [same as state materials office (SMO)]: http://databases.sm.dot.state.fl.us/fpdb/strg.asp http://databases.sm.dot.state.fl.us/fpdb/strg.asp A material Id coming up as a general material certification that needs to be scanned into hummingbird will have “SCAN INTO CDMS” under sample size. All other general material certifications will require “1 COPY” logged in LIMS and sent to the SMO laboratory with the LIMS-Sample ID or will specify “CHECK QPL” Also see: Materials Bulletin # 10-08 “Changes to Logging Samples”: http://www.dot.state.fl.us/construction/memos/2 008/DCE23-08Rev.pdfhttp://www.dot.state.fl.us/construction/memos/2 008/DCE23-08Rev.pdf
